Language and Culture in Children's Media
This chapter delves into how language and cultural representation are depicted in children's media, with a focus on animated shows. It discusses the critique of stereotypes, compares portrayals across different media, and highlights the progression toward more inclusive depictions, citing examples like Bluey's representation of a deaf character.
